Biography

Founded in 2007, The New Roses is a German hard rock band from Wiesbaden, Germany formed by singer Timmy Rough and drummer Urban Berz, expanding in 2012 to include Stefan Kassner (bass) and Dizzy Presley (guitar). Self-releasing their first self-titled EP in December that year, the band's debut album Without a Trace (2013) propelled them into the spotlight after the album's title track was featured in popular U.S television series Sons of Anarchy. In 2014, Kassner and Presley were replaced by Norman Bites (guitar) and Hardy (bass) and the band's second album Dead Man’s Voice, featuring top 50 single “Thirsty”, preceded a sold-out concert in Germany, followed by a festival tour with the band touring with English heavy metal band Saxon and supergroup The Dead Daisies. Shortly after, the band released popular singles “Every Wild Heart” and hard rock anthem "Life Ain't Easy (For A Boy with Long Hair)" from their top 20 album One More for the Road (2017) before travelling to Afghanistan and performing for multinational troops in Camp Marmal in Mazar i Sharif. Two years later, with their trademark riffs and Southern-inspired rock sound, the band's fourth album  Nothing But Wild (2019) was received enthusiastically by fans with the release peaking at number 10, before the group embarked on another tour with  major rock bands Scorpions and KISS. In 2022, The New Roses delivered two new singles “The Usual Suspects” and “1st Time For Everything” to critical acclaim, with their fifth studio album Sweet Poison released on October 21, 2022, debuting at number 13 in Germany and number 37 in Switzerland.
